Linux 系统下 VPN 安装与使用教程

目录

  1. VPN 简介
  2. Linux 系统下 VPN 安装
    1. 使用 Clash 客户端
    2. 手动配置 OpenVPN
  3. VPN 使用技巧
    1. 连接 VPN 服务器
    2. 优化 VPN 性能
  4. 常见问题解答

VPN 简介

VPN(Virtual Private Network,虚拟私有网络)是一种安全的网络技术,它能够通过公共网络如 Internet 建立一条加密的通信隧道,为用户提供安全可靠的网络访问。在日常生活中,VPN 广泛应用于隐私保护、内网访问、跨地域办公等场景。

Linux 作为开源操作系统,拥有丰富的 VPN 解决方案。本文将重点介绍 Linux 系统下两种常见的 VPN 安装与使用方法,帮助读者轻松掌握 Linux 平台下的 VPN 技能。

Linux 系统下 VPN 安装

使用 Clash 客户端

Clash 是一款跨平台的代理客户端软件,支持多种代理协议包括 Shadowsocks、Trojan 和 VMess 等。Clash 在 Linux 平台上的安装和使用非常方便,以下是具体步骤:

  1. 下载 Clash 客户端
  2. 解压安装包
    • 使用 tar -xzf clash-linux-amd64-v1.11.8.gz 命令解压安装包。
  3. 运行 Clash 客户端
    • 进入解压后的目录,使用 ./clash 命令运行 Clash 客户端。
  4. 导入 VPN 配置文件
    • 在 Clash 客户端界面,点击 “Profiles” 选项卡,选择 “Import” 导入您的 VPN 配置文件。
  5. 连接 VPN 服务器
    • 选择合适的 VPN 节点,点击 “Connect” 即可建立 VPN 连接。

使用 Clash 客户端安装 VPN 的优点是操作简单,配置灵活,同时也支持多种代理协议。对于新手用户来说,这是一个非常友好的 VPN 安装方式。

手动配置 OpenVPN

OpenVPN 是一款开源的 VPN 解决方案,广泛应用于各种操作系统平台。以下是在 Linux 系统下手动配置 OpenVPN 的步骤:

  1. 安装 OpenVPN 软件包
    • 使用 sudo apt-get install openvpn 命令在 Ubuntu/Debian 系统上安装 OpenVPN。
    • 在 CentOS/RHEL 系统上,使用 sudo yum install openvpn 命令安装。
  2. 下载 VPN 配置文件
    • 从您的 VPN 服务提供商处获取 OpenVPN 配置文件,通常包括 .ovpn 后缀的文件。
  3. 导入 VPN 配置文件
    • 将下载的 .ovpn 文件复制到 /etc/openvpn/ 目录下。
  4. 连接 VPN 服务器
    • 使用 sudo openvpn --config /etc/openvpn/your-vpn-config.ovpn 命令连接 VPN 服务器。

手动配置 OpenVPN 的优点是灵活性强,可以完全掌控 VPN 的配置过程。但对于新手用户来说,可能需要花费一些时间去理解 OpenVPN 的配置文件和命令。

VPN 使用技巧

连接 VPN 服务器

无论使用 Clash 还是 OpenVPN,连接 VPN 服务器的基本步骤都是相同的:

  1. 选择合适的 VPN 节点或配置文件
  2. 点击/执行连接命令
  3. 等待 VPN 连接建立成功

连接成功后,您可以通过 pingcurl 命令验证 VPN 是否正常工作。如果出现任何问题,可以查看客户端软件或系统日志,排查故障原因。

优化 VPN 性能

为了获得更好的 VPN 使用体验,可以尝试以下优化技巧:

  • 选择就近的 VPN 服务器:选择地理位置与您所在地较近的 VPN 服务器,可以降低网络延迟,提高传输速度。
  • 调整 VPN 协议:不同的 VPN 协议在速度、安全性和兼容性上有所差异,您可以尝试切换协议以获得更佳性能。
  • 开启 VPN 分流:部分 VPN 客户端支持分流功能,可以仅将特定流量通过 VPN 隧道传输,提高整体网络速度。
  • 优化系统网络设置:调整 DNS 服务器、MTU 值等网络参数,也可以提升 VPN 的传输性能。

常见问题解答

为什么连接 VPN 后上网速度变慢?

VPN 会为网络流量增加额外的加密和隧道传输开销,因此在某些情况下会导致上网速度变慢。您可以尝试优化 VPN 的使用方式,如选择就近的 VPN 服务器、调整 VPN 协议等,以提高网速。

VPN 能够解决什么问题?

VPN 主要可以帮助您解决以下问题:

  • 隐藏您的 IP 地址:通过 VPN 连接,您的真实 IP 地址会被 VPN 服务器的 IP 地址替代,从而隐藏您的身份。
  • 绕过网络限制:一些网站或服务可能会针对特定地区进行访问限制,使用 VPN 可以绕过这些限制。
  • 保护隐私安全:VPN 提供的加密隧道可以有效保护您的网络通信不被监听或篡改。

如何选择合适的 VPN 服务商?

选择 VPN 服务商时,您需要考虑以下因素:

  • 服务器覆盖范围:VPN 服务商应该拥有广泛的服务器网络,以满足您的地理位置需求。
  • 网络速度和稳定性:VPN 服务的网络性能直接影响您的上网体验,请仔细评估。
  • 隐私政策:查看 VPN 服务商的隐私政策,了解他们是否会记录用户日志。
  • 价格和付费方式:根据自己的需求选择合适的付费方案。

综合考虑以上因素,您可以选择一家信赖的 VPN 服务商。

正文完